About Xibei Yang

Xibei Yang is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ition, Electrical and Electronic Engineering, Media Technology and Information Systems, having authored 27 papers that have together received 699 indexed citations. Recurring topics across this work include Imbalanced Data Classification Techniques (13 papers), Machine Learning and ELM (13 papers), Domain Adaptation and Few-Shot Learning (9 papers), Face and Expression Recognition (7 papers), Electricity Theft Detection Techniques (4 papers), Anomaly Detection Techniques and Applications (4 papers), Machine Learning and Algorithms (4 papers) and Text and Document Classification Technologies (3 papers). The work is most often cited by research in Artificial Intelligence (541 citations), Health Information Management (30 citations), Computer Vision and Pattern Recognition (114 citations), Accounting (49 citations) and Media Technology (36 citations). Xibei Yang has collaborated with scholars based in China, Hong Kong and South Korea. Frequent co-authors include Hualong Yu, Changyin Sun, Shang Zheng, Shang Gao, Xin Zuo, Wankou Yang, Chaoxu Mu, Jifeng Shen, Yunsong Qi and Wankou Yang. Their work appears in journals such as Neural Processing Letters, Knowledge-Based Systems, IEEE Access, Neurocomputing and Applied Intelligence.
